Joey Alexander to perform at Dizzy’s Club from October 1-3

In October 2021, Grammy-nominated jazz pianist Joey Alexander will be performing at Dizzy’s Club—located inside New York’s Lincoln Center. Here’s the scoop:

Seven years ago, Joey Alexander debuted as a talented jazz instrumentalist. He has performed at the GRAMMYs and landed on several Billboard charts (My Favorite Things and Countdown peaked at No. 1 on Billboard 200 as well as the Traditional Jazz Albums charts). Warna peaked at #20 on the Billboard 200. Also, Joey Alexander’s music is featured on Legion of Peace, a Lori Henriques Quintet album.

Now, Joey Alexander will be performing two exclusive shows with his band at Dizzy’s Club on October 1, October 2, and October 3. The first show starts at 7:30 PM EST and the second show begins at 9:30 PM EST. Kris Funn (bass) and Kush Abadey (drums) will join him onstage. Click here for more information.

“I always communicate musically. I want my band not only to learn the form and feel of the song by ear, like I do, but also have the freedom to contribute,” Joey Alexander voiced.

Multi-Grammy winning composer John Williams to perform at Hollywood Bowl

Multi-Grammy winning composer John Williams will be performing at the Hollywood Bowl. Here’s the scoop:

John Williams is a legendary composer and maestro of the movies. Williams won 24 Grammy awards, 7 British Academy Film awards, 5 Academy awards and 4 Golden Globe awards. Williams has composed some of the most recognizable film scores that people may recall from their childhood. Williams’ outstanding film scores are featured in a long list of movies including Star Wars: The Force Awakens and Harry Potter and the Sorcerer’s Stone.

In addition, Williams composed several film scores for Steven Spielberg’s films including Close Encounters of the Third Kind and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ade. The Close Encounters of the Third Kind theme peaked at No. 13 on Billboard‘s adult contemporary charts. Williams’ career spans over sixty years, and he is inducted in Hollywood Bowl’s Hall of Fame.

This year, John Williams is celebrating the 40th anniversary of his official debut at the Hollywood Bowl. His upcoming performance will feature his most popular film scores. In addition, some of the cinematic selections will feature film scenes playing in the background.
